Abstract

The deformation resistance of siliconmanganese TRIP steel at different deformation temperature and strain rate is discussed. The stressstrain curve at deformation rate of 1 s-1, 10 s-1, 20 s-1, 75% deformation ratio and deformation temperature of 1 200 ℃, 1 100 ℃, 1 000 ℃, 900 ℃ and 800 ℃ is determined by Gleeble1500 thermalmechanical simulator. The deformation resistance results of TRIP steel are fitted by using software SPASS and the influence deformation condition on the deformation resistance is simulated, then the mathematical model formula is obtained. The average absolute error is less than 5 MPa, the average relative errors are less than 5 percent, the largest absolute error is less than 10 MPa, and the maximum relative error is less than 15%. These results show that the error is relatively small. The calculated results are in the permissible range. The experimental results show that the true stress is stable after 04 true strain. Below 1 100 ℃, work hardening is more obvious. The result shows that the temperature is lower, and workhardening rate (n value) is higher.
